#3e4eb5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e4eb5 is composed of 24.3% red, 30.6%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.7%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 231.9 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 47.6%. #3e4eb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c9cff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3e4eb5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e4eb5 has RGB values of R:62, G:78,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 4083381.

Shades and Tints of #3e4eb5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020206 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fc is the lightest one.
